The Reynolds Adolescent Depression Scale (RADS-2) is a brief self-report report measure that evaluates an adolescent's level of depression in the following areas: Dysphoric Mood, Anhedonia/Negative Affect, Negative Self-Evaluation, and Somatic Complaints.

Four scales assess the underlying dimensions of adolescent depression.
William M. Reynolds, Ph. D.

  • Age Range: 11-20 years
  • Time: 5-10 minutes, group or individual administration

RADS-2 is a brief, 30-item, self report measure that evaluates an adolescent's level of depression in the following areas: Dysphoric Mood, Anhedonia/Negative Affect, Negative Self-Evaluation, Somatic Complaints

Interpretation of these subscales is based on both the nature of the depression domain, and the content of the subscale. Scores identify the clinical severity of the depressive symptoms as normal, mild, moderate or severe.

RADS-2 also yields a Depression Total score, representing the overall severity of depressive symptomology. This is particularly useful in alerting professionals to adolescents who may be experiencing a significant amount of depression.

RADS-2 has been restandardized with a new school-based sample of 3,300 adolescents, stratified for gender and ethnicity, based on the Year 2000 Census. Its updated normative tables provide standard scores and percentile ranks for both the Depression Total and the four subscales.
